A "rollicking and bawdy" tale of eighteenth-century England, inspired by Fanny Hill, from the New York Times–bestselling author of Fear of Flying ( The Plain Dealer).   Galloping from England to Africa to the high seas of the Caribbean, bestselling author Erica Jong's "perverse epic" follows the amorous adventures of a woman of pleasure and pluck ( The New York Times). Falling in with randy highwaymen, witches, kidnappers, pirate queens, prostitutes, and such luminaries as Jonathan Swift, William Hogarth, and Alexander Pope, Fanny is seeking much more than fortune. In this unexpurgated "memoir" by the girl made famous in John Cleland's notorious Fanny Hill, our dauntless heroine finally reveals what really made her.   Life begins somewhat ignobly for Fanny Hackabout-Jones. Abandoned as an infant on the doorstep of Lord and Lady Bellars's grand Wiltshire manor, she contemplates the literary life as she grows to ripe young womanhood. Fanny chooses, however, to pursue a very different future when she flees to London to escape the mortifying advances of her adoptive father. There, on the road, her life truly begins. Cast by pernicious Fate—and her own audacious will—into a series of astonishing escapades, Fanny learns that a woman's lot is not an easy one in these oppressive times. But she will not be discouraged, nor will she falter, on the uneven path toward notoriety, self-discovery, motherhood, and love. This is a delightful twist on classic literature—and "Erica Jong was the right person to write it" (Anthony Burgess, Saturday Review).   This ebook features an illustrated biography of Erica Jong including rare photos and never-before-seen documents from the author's personal collection.
